I am guessing someone in the family added this element as a surprise for them and didn't want to be named. I really can't see them just adding this as a "gift" for several reasons. It wouldn't be fair to all the brides that didn't get him, what if the bride really would have preferred Donald, or Minnie, etc... They aren't known for giving away $1000 "gift". It would set a precedence that other brides would expect and complain about if they didn't get.
 
There are 2 remote ways I could see this happening. First is if disney had made some HUGE error on something and was doing this to make up for it.
Second would be if they had it in their original plan and cancelled it at the end, my old planner told me that happens sometimes and no one gets the information to the other department and the couple gets that element free. I saw it happen with upgraded chairs at my planning session.
